Camperdown Cemetery Trust $15,000

Essential conservation works to the Ship’s anchor within the Dunbar Tomb and Precinct

The Dunbar tomb and precinct (1858), located in Camperdown Cemetery, is a mass grave memorial for the victims of the Dunbar shipwreck, a tragedy of great maritime significance.  The proposed conservation works are planned in time for a 160th year memorial service.

Richmond River Historical Society Inc. $5,750

Lismore by the Sea 

The Society holds a number of artefacts relating to specific vessels that served on the North Coast run.  This project is for the reorganization of the maritime display to contemporary professional standard with inclusion of interpretive media to elicit the role of the North Coast Steam Navigation Company in the maritime history of the region. Consultants will be engaged to facilitate the production of the display. Some unique and valuable artefacts relating to this story, including a lantern from the ‘Lady Franklin’, and a sextant, parallel rules and dividers owned by captain Hunter, master of the first ‘Wollongbar’ that was wrecked in Byron Bay in 1921 will be rehoused in display cabinets for highlighting and protection. 

Tathra Pig & Whistle Line Museum $2,720

Preservation, interpretation and exhibition of the Tathra Surf Boat

The Tathra Surf Boat is a wooden framed, canvas covered double ended craft. The proposed project aims to ensure appropriate and ongoing public access to the vessel by undertaking preservation and interpretation of the craft which is rare and important part of the museum’s collection.  The vessel has recently been listed on the Australian Register for Historic Vessels (ARHV) and the proposed project is based on recommendations contained in the vessel’s Conservation and Interpretation Plan.

Bwgcolman Community School $15,000

Palm Island Maritime Heritage Research Project

To engage students & members of the Palm Island Community in a maritime heritage project.  Aims include; assisting students to develop research skills, record oral histories, engage with practical boat building & boat repairs skills development as well as to develop teaching and learning resources.  The project will identify design details of boats traditionally built on Palm Island & investigate if one of these vessels could be recreated on the Island via a future project.

Discovery Coast Tourism and Commerce Inc. $15,000

The 1770 Experience

For the development of the Interpretation Concept Plan for the ‘1770 Experience’.  The community’s plan is to celebrate Cook 250 in 1770 by creating a long lasting community asset including a monument, a botanic parkland and an interpretive centre, which tells the story of indigenous cultural heritage, environmental significance and Australian maritime history on the occasion of the 250th anniversary of Cook’s landing at the site of the Town of 1770.

Maritime Museum of Tasmania $12,173

Conserving Tasmanian China Trade paintings

To have two significant oil paintings in the Maritime Museum’s collection repaired and conserved. The works, created by Chinese artists in Hong Kong are ships’ portraits of the Mary Blair and Wild Wave, two Tasmanian vessels engaged in the China trade around the 1860s.  They can then be shared with the museum's community and visitors, along with the fascinating story Tasmania’s trade links with China during the 1800s.

Echuca Historical Society Inc. In-Kind Support

Purchase of a Plan Drawer Cabinet and a Glass Display Unit

This collection relates to the many Paddle Steamers that were part of the early and busy Murray trading history of the Port of Echuca.  This organisation has a large room in which to display their Maritime collections and are currently working to place collection items on show in a visual and safe manner. For those items not on display they also need to ensure they have excellent facilities for storage.  In-kind support is awarded for ANMM support and freight costs to deliver an ex-ANMM showcase.

Albany’s Historic Whaling Station $13,546

Cheynes IV Whale Chasing Interpretation

For an ‘ultimate experience’; visitors to the Radar Room will ‘experience’ a whale chase as if they were the whale harpoonist, experiencing a variety of senses; visual, proprioceptual, auditory and touch.  Footage of whale chasing from 40 years ago will be used.
